2-aminoethoxydiphenyl borate: is a novel membrane-penetrable modulator and transient receptor potential channel blocker; structure in first source; do not confuse with 2-APB cpd
2-aminoethoxydiphenylborane : An organoboron compound that is diphenylborane in which the borane hydrogen is replaced by a 2-aminoethoxy group.
Rett Syndrome: An inherited neurological developmental disorder that is associated with X-LINKED INHERITANCE and may be lethal in utero to hemizygous males. The affected female is normal until the age of 6-25 months when progressive loss of voluntary control of hand movements and communication skills; ATAXIA; SEIZURES; autistic behavior; intermittent HYPERVENTILATION; and HYPERAMMONEMIA appear.
